Samuel Adams had 12 siblings but only 2 made it to adulthood. he also signed the declaration of indepenence, organized the Boston tea party, and put a stop to the stamp act. He attended Harvard college at the age of 13 and graduated in 1740. He got his masters degree in 1743. there are many more facts but theese are just a couple.
